MDBF Logo MDBF

O Que É Protocolos: Guia Completo para Entender o Tema

Artigos

No mundo da tecnologia e das comunicações, o termo "protocolos" aparece com frequência e influencia nossa rotina de formas muitas vezes invisíveis. Desde o envio de um e-mail até o funcionamento da internet, os protocolos desempenham um papel essencial na garantia de que os processos ocorram de maneira eficiente, segura e padronizada.

Mas o que exatamente são esses protocolos? Como eles funcionam? E por que são tão importantes? Este guia completo foi criado para responder a todas essas perguntas, ajudando você a entender de forma clara e objetiva o conceito de protocolos, seus tipos e aplicações no dia a dia.

o-que-e-protocolos

O Que É um Protocolo?

De forma geral, um protocolo é um conjunto de regras e normas que permitem a comunicação entre diferentes dispositivos, sistemas ou pessoas. Essas regras garantem que as informações sejam transmitidas de forma correta, segura e compreensível para todas as partes envolvidas.

Por exemplo, ao enviar uma mensagem de texto no celular, diferentes protocolos são utilizados para assegurar que a mensagem chegue ao destinatário de forma íntegra e rápida. Assim como em uma reunião formal, onde há regras de conduta, os protocolos tecnológicos oferecem um padrão para que a comunicação seja eficiente.

Importância dos Protocolos

A presença de protocolos padroniza processos e garante interoperabilidade entre diferentes sistemas e dispositivos. Sem eles, a comunicação digital seria caótica e ineficiente.

Segundo o especialista em redes de computadores, Andrew S. Tanenbaum, "sem protocolos, toda comunicação digital seria um caos, impossível de organizar". Essa citação reforça a ideia de que os protocolos são a espinha dorsal da comunicação moderna.

Classificação dos Protocolos

Existem diversos tipos de protocolos, cada um destinado a uma função específica. A seguir, apresentamos os principais:

Tipo de ProtocoloFunção PrincipalExemplos
Protocolos de ComunicaçãoGerenciar a transmissão de dados entre dispositivosTCP/IP, UDP
Protocolos de RedeControlar a troca de informações em redesHTTP, HTTPS, FTP
Protocolos de SegurançaAssegurar privacidade e integridade de dadosSSL/TLS, SSH
Protocolos de AplicaçãoDefinir as regras para aplicações específicasSMTP (e-mail), DNS (resolução de nomes)

Protocolos de Comunicação

São essenciais para estabelecer conexões entre dispositivos, definindo como os dados são enviados e recebidos. O TCP/IP é o mais conhecido, sendo fundamental na estrutura da internet.

Protocolos de Segurança

Provedores e usuários cada vez mais valorizam a segurança na comunicação digital. Protocolos como SSL/TLS garantem criptografia nas transmissões, protegendo informações confidenciais.

Protocolos de Aplicação

Regem o funcionamento de aplicações específicas, como o envio de e-mails (SMTP) ou a navegação na web (HTTP/HTTPS).

Como Funcionam os Protocolos na Prática?

Para entender melhor, vamos acompanhar como funciona a transmissão de uma página web:

  1. O usuário digita um endereço no navegador (exemplo.com).
  2. O navegador utiliza o protocolo HTTP para solicitar o conteúdo ao servidor.
  3. A requisição é enviada através de uma rede de computadores, usando protocolos de rede como TCP/IP.
  4. O servidor responde enviando os dados da página, também usando protocolos definidos.
  5. Caso o site utilize criptografia, o HTTPS com SSL/TLS garante a segurança na transmissão.
  6. O navegador exibe a página ao usuário.

Esse processo ocorre em questão de milissegundos, evidenciando a complexidade e a importância dos protocolos na comunicação digital.

Protocolos na Internet: Uma Visão Geral

A internet, hoje, depende de uma enorme variedade de protocolos para funcionar. Aqui está uma descrição resumida de alguns dos principais:

  • IP (Internet Protocol): Responsável pelo endereçamento e roteamento dos pacotes de dados.
  • TCP (Transmission Control Protocol): Garante que os dados cheguem completos e na ordem correta.
  • HTTP/HTTPS: Protocolos para transferência de páginas web, sendo HTTPS uma versão segura.
  • FTP (File Transfer Protocol): Permite a transferência de arquivos entre computadores.
  • DNS (Domain Name System): Traduza nomes de domínios em endereços IP.

Fluxo de Dados na Internet

Um diagrama resumido do fluxo de dados na internet pode ser visualizado na tabela a seguir:

EtapaDescriçãoProtocolos Envolvidos
Digitação do endereçoUsuário acessa um site digitando seu URLDNS, HTTP/HTTPS
Resolução de nomeDNS encontra o endereço IP do siteDNS
Solicitação ao servidorRequisição enviada com TCP/IPTCP, IP
Resposta do servidorDados enviados ao navegadorTCP, IP, HTTP/HTTPS
Apresentação ao usuárioPágina exibida no navegadorBrowser (aplicação)

Protocolos e Segurança Digital

A segurança na comunicação digital é uma preocupação crescente. Protocolos específicos são utilizados para proteger os dados, garantir autenticação e evitar ataques cibernéticos.

Protocolos de Segurança mais Utilizados

  • SSL/TLS: Criptografia de ponta a ponta em sites e aplicativos.
  • SSH (Secure Shell): Acesso seguro a servidores remotos.
  • IPSec: Proteção de dados na camada de rede.

Para garantir a segurança na navegação, vale sempre conferir se o site possui o cadeado de segurança na barra do navegador, indicando o uso de HTTPS.

Como os Protocolos Impactam Nossa Vida Diária?

Eles são onipresentes, mesmo quando não percebemos. Algumas aplicações do nosso cotidiano que dependem de protocolos incluem:

  • Navegação na web
  • Envio de e-mails
  • Transferência de arquivos na nuvem
  • Uso de aplicativos de mensagens
  • Compras online

Por trás de cada interação digital, há uma cadeia de protocolos trabalhando em harmonia para tornar tudo possível.

Perguntas Frequentes (FAQs)

1. O que é um protocolo de rede?

Um protocolo de rede estabelece as regras para a troca de dados entre dispositivos conectados em uma rede, como a internet. Exemplos incluem TCP, IP, HTTP, FTP e DNS.

2. Qual a diferença entre TCP e IP?

O IP é responsável pelo endereçamento e entrega dos pacotes de dados, enquanto o TCP garante que esses pacotes sejam recebidos na ordem correta e sem perdas.

3. Por que é importante usar HTTPS?

O HTTPS utiliza criptografia com SSL/TLS, protegendo a privacidade dos dados transmitidos, o que é fundamental em transações online e navegação segura.

4. Como os protocolos garantem a segurança na internet?

Através de mecanismos de criptografia, autenticação e integridade, protocolos como SSL/TLS e SSH evitam interceptação e acesso não autorizado a informações confidenciais.

5. Existem outros protocolos além dos citados?

Sim. A lista de protocolos é extensa e inclui muitos outros, cada um com funções específicas, como o SNMP para gerenciamento de redes ou o IMAP para acesso a e-mails.

Conclusão

Os protocolos são a espinha dorsal da comunicação digital, responsáveis por garantir que a troca de informações seja eficiente, segura e interoperável. Entender sua função, importância e funcionamento ajuda a reconhecer a complexidade por trás das tecnologias que usamos todos os dias.

Seja na conexão à internet, no envio de um e-mail ou na navegação por um site, os protocolos estão presentes, operando em segundo plano, mas de forma essencial. Como afirmou o renomado cientista da computação, David P. Reed, "A infraestrutura da internet é uma grande arquitetura de protocolos em evolução, projetada para conectar pessoas, informação e aplicação de maneiras inovadoras."

Para aprofundar seus conhecimentos, recomendamos consultar fontes especializadas, como W3C - Protocolos na Web e Cisco - Protocolos de Rede.

Referências